The greater Columbia community thrives on the influx of students to our colleges and universities. Thousands of students, parents, and fans flock to Columbia annually to attend classes and participate in sporting events and campus activities.
As students prepare to return to fall classes, these institutions are faced with not only the health challenges of safely returning students during the COVID pandemic, they also must brace for changes in enrollment numbers, online participation, economic shortfalls, faculty and staff needs, and in goods and service providers.
Join us for a discussion with our top education leaders on these topics and more.
